11. How Much Does a Plumber Cost in Vancouver?
Plumbing costs in Vancouver can vary depending on the company, urgency of the call, job complexity, and whether materials are required. Emergency and after-hours work will typically cost more than standard daytime service.
Typical Plumbing Prices in Vancouver
Standard Service Call: $120β$220+
Drain Cleaning: $150β$400+
Toilet Repair / Install: $250β$600+
Faucet Installation: $180β$450+
Hot Water Tank Install: $1,800β$4,000+
Leak Detection / Repair: $200β$900+
Sewer Line Repair: $1,500β$10,000+
Emergency After-Hours Call: Premium rates
What Impacts Cost?
1. Time of Day
Evenings, weekends, and holidays often come with higher rates.
2. Job Complexity
Simple faucet replacements are far cheaper than opening walls or repairing sewer lines.
3. Materials Needed
Fixtures, tanks, piping, and valves can significantly impact final pricing.
4. Experience & Reputation
Highly rated, established companies may charge more β but often save money long-term through better workmanship.
Pro Tip
The cheapest quote is not always the best quote. Poor plumbing work can lead to water damage, mold, and expensive rework.
12. What to Look for in a Vancouver Plumber
Choosing the right plumber can save you major headaches. Hereβs what matters most:
1. Proper Licensing & Insurance
Always choose a properly licensed and insured company. This protects you and ensures code-compliant work.
2. Strong Google Reviews
Look for consistent positive reviews, not just a high star rating. Read comments about punctuality, cleanliness, communication, and pricing.
3. Clear Pricing
Good plumbers explain pricing upfront and communicate any changes before proceeding.
4. Fast Response Times
If you have a leak or backup, speed matters. Companies with responsive dispatch systems are valuable.
5. Relevant Experience
Different plumbers specialize in different areas:
Drain issues β Rooter / drain specialist
Renovations β Install / project plumber
Heating systems β Boiler / HVAC plumbing
Emergencies β Larger dispatch company
6. Warranty or Work Guarantee
Reputable companies often stand behind their labor and parts.
7. Professionalism
Look for:
Clean vehicles
Uniformed staff
Respectful communication
Organized invoices
Professional website / presence

What do plumbers charge per hour in Vancouver?
Most plumbers charge around $120β$220+ per hour, depending on company and service type.
Are emergency plumbers more expensive?
Yes. Evening, weekend, and urgent same-day calls usually carry premium pricing.
How fast can a plumber come out?
Many companies offer same-day service. Emergency-focused companies may dispatch faster.
Should I get multiple quotes?
For large projects like sewer repairs, repiping, or hot water tank installs, yes. For urgent leaks or backups, speed may matter more than shopping quotes.
Is it worth paying more for a reputable plumber?
Usually yes. Quality work often prevents repeat repairs, water damage, and frustration.
